Abstract
Det er beskrevet en apparatur for å fremstille ortohydrogen og/eller parahydrogen. Apparaturen omfatter en beholder inneholdende vann og minst ett par av elektroder som befinner seg i nær avstand til hverandre anordnet i beholderen og neddykket i vannet. En første krafttilførsel tilveiebringer et spesielt første pulset signal til elektrodene. En spole kan også være anordnet inne i beholderen og neddykket i vannet dersom fremstillingen av parahydrogen også er påkrevet. En andre krafttilførsel tilveiebringer et andre pulset signal til spolen gjennom en bryter for å tilføre energi til vannet. Når den andre krafttilførselen kobles fra spolen ved hjelp av bryteren og bare elektrodene mottar et pulset signal kan ortohydrogen fremstilles. Når den andre krafttilførselen er forbundet med spolen og både elektrodene og spolen mottar pulsede signaler kan de første og andre pulsede signalene kontrolleres for å fremstille parahydrogen. Beholderen er selv-trykksettende og vannet i beholderen kreve.r ingen kjemisk katalysator for effektivt å fremstille ortohydrogenet og/eller parahydrogenet. Varme genereres ikke, og bobler dannes ikke på elektrodene.
